Understanding Cleat Anatomy and Materials
Before diving into why cleats rip, let’s break down their construction. Understanding the different parts and materials is crucial for identifying potential weak points. Cleats are complex pieces of equipment, designed to withstand significant stress and provide optimal grip and support.
The Upper
The upper is the part of the cleat that covers your foot. It’s typically made from a variety of materials, each with its own advantages and disadvantages:
- Leather: Traditionally, leather was a popular choice for cleat uppers due to its durability and natural flexibility. However, leather requires more maintenance and can stretch over time. It’s also susceptible to cracking if not properly cared for.
- Synthetic Materials: Modern cleats often utilize synthetic materials like polyurethane (PU) or microfiber. These offer several benefits, including lighter weight, water resistance, and easier maintenance. They can also be molded into various shapes and designs, enhancing the cleat’s performance. However, some synthetic materials may be less durable than leather, especially in high-wear areas.
- Knit Uppers: Knit uppers are becoming increasingly popular, particularly in soccer cleats. They provide a sock-like fit, offering excellent flexibility and breathability. However, the thinness of the knit material can make it more prone to tearing if exposed to abrasion or sharp objects.
The Midsole
The midsole provides cushioning and support. It’s usually made of foam materials like EVA (ethylene-vinyl acetate) or TPU (thermoplastic polyurethane). The midsole absorbs shock and helps distribute pressure, contributing to comfort and performance. Damage to the midsole can affect the cleat’s stability and overall lifespan.
The Outsole
The outsole is the bottom part of the cleat, featuring the studs or blades that provide traction. It’s typically made of durable materials like TPU or rubber. The design and arrangement of the studs vary depending on the sport and playing surface. The outsole is subjected to significant wear and tear, especially during quick movements and changes in direction. The studs themselves can wear down or break off over time.
The Studs/blades
These are the key components for traction. They are typically made from TPU or rubber and are designed to penetrate the playing surface to provide grip. The shape, size, and arrangement of the studs or blades vary depending on the sport and the playing surface (e.g., grass, artificial turf). Damage to studs can compromise traction and increase the risk of injury. Studs can wear down, break off, or become loose over time.
Common Causes of Cleat Ripping
Now, let’s explore the primary reasons why cleats rip. Several factors contribute to cleat failure, ranging from material defects to improper use.
Material Degradation

- Sunlight: Prolonged exposure to sunlight can cause synthetic materials to become brittle and crack.
- Moisture: Repeated exposure to water and sweat can weaken the glue and stitching, leading to separation of the upper and sole.
- Heat: High temperatures can accelerate material breakdown, making the cleats more susceptible to tearing.
- Age: The older the cleats, the more likely they are to experience material degradation.
Improper Fit
A cleat that doesn’t fit properly can put excessive stress on certain areas, leading to premature failure:
- Too Tight: A cleat that’s too tight can restrict movement and put excessive pressure on the seams and uppers, leading to tearing.
- Too Loose: A loose cleat allows the foot to slide around, causing friction and abrasion, which can damage the upper and lining.
- Incorrect Size: Wearing the wrong size can affect the overall fit and lead to pressure points and premature wear.
Poor Quality Materials or Manufacturing Defects
Sometimes, the cleat rips due to issues during the manufacturing process or the use of substandard materials:
- Weak Seams: Poorly stitched seams are prone to tearing, especially in high-stress areas.
- Low-Quality Glue: If the glue used to attach the sole to the upper is weak, the two parts may separate easily.
- Material Flaws: Defects in the materials, such as thin spots or weak areas in the synthetic upper, can lead to tears.
Excessive Wear and Tear
The intensity of play and the playing surface significantly impact cleat longevity:
- High-Impact Sports: Sports with frequent quick movements, such as soccer, football, and baseball, put more stress on the cleats.
- Rough Surfaces: Playing on abrasive surfaces like artificial turf or concrete can accelerate wear and tear.
- Frequent Use: The more you play, the faster your cleats will wear out.
Improper Care and Maintenance
Neglecting your cleats can significantly shorten their lifespan:
- Lack of Cleaning: Leaving dirt and debris on the cleats can degrade the materials and accelerate wear.
- Improper Storage: Storing cleats in extreme temperatures or damp environments can damage the materials.
- Ignoring Repairs: Delaying repairs, such as fixing loose studs or small tears, can worsen the damage.
External Factors
Sometimes, external factors contribute to cleat damage:
- Sharp Objects: Stepping on sharp objects, such as rocks or glass, can cut or puncture the cleat.
- Collisions: Collisions with other players or objects can cause tears or damage to the cleats.
- Incorrect Use on Surface: Using cleats designed for grass on artificial turf, or vice versa, can accelerate wear and tear.
How to Prevent Cleat Ripping
Fortunately, you can take several steps to minimize the risk of your cleats ripping and extend their lifespan. Following these tips can help you get the most out of your investment.
Choose the Right Cleats
Selecting the appropriate cleats for your sport and playing style is crucial:
- Consider the Sport: Different sports require different cleat designs. For example, soccer cleats have conical studs for agility, while football cleats have longer, more aggressive studs for traction.
- Assess the Playing Surface: Choose cleats designed for the surface you play on. Using the wrong type of cleat can lead to premature wear and tear.
- Prioritize Quality: Invest in cleats from reputable brands known for their durability and quality construction.
- Read Reviews: Research different cleat models and read reviews to learn about their performance and durability.
Ensure Proper Fit

- Measure Your Feet: Have your feet professionally measured to determine your correct shoe size.
- Try Them On: Always try on cleats before buying them, preferably with the socks you’ll wear during games.
- Check for Comfort: The cleats should fit snugly without being too tight. There should be enough room for your toes to move slightly.
- Walk Around: Walk around in the cleats to ensure they don’t pinch or cause discomfort.
Proper Care and Maintenance
Regular maintenance can significantly extend the life of your cleats:
- Clean After Use: After each game or practice, clean your cleats with a brush and mild soap to remove dirt and debris.
- Air Dry: Allow your cleats to air dry completely, away from direct sunlight or heat.
- Store Properly: Store your cleats in a cool, dry place, away from extreme temperatures and moisture. Consider using a shoe bag or box.
- Regular Inspection: Inspect your cleats regularly for signs of wear and tear, such as loose studs or small tears.
Repair Minor Damage Promptly
Addressing minor damage quickly can prevent it from worsening:
- Tighten Loose Studs: If a stud becomes loose, tighten it immediately to prevent it from falling out.
- Repair Small Tears: Use a suitable adhesive or seek professional repair for small tears in the upper.
- Replace Worn Studs: Replace worn or damaged studs to maintain optimal traction.
- Professional Repairs: For more significant damage, consider taking your cleats to a professional cobbler or shoe repair shop.
Avoid Overuse
Giving your cleats a break can help extend their lifespan. Consider having multiple pairs of cleats if you play frequently:
- Rotate Cleats: If possible, rotate between two or more pairs of cleats to reduce wear and tear on any single pair.
- Use Different Cleats for Practice and Games: If you play frequently, consider using one pair for practice and another for games.
- Avoid Using Cleats on Hard Surfaces: If possible, avoid wearing cleats on hard surfaces like concrete or asphalt, as this can accelerate wear.
Protective Measures
Take steps to protect your cleats from potential damage:
- Avoid Sharp Objects: Be mindful of sharp objects on the playing surface, such as rocks or glass.
- Use a Shoe Bag: Use a shoe bag or box to protect your cleats during transport and storage.
- Consider a Protective Coating: Some products are available to protect the upper from water and abrasion.
The Role of Playing Surface
The surface you play on significantly impacts cleat wear and tear. Different surfaces put different stresses on cleats, and choosing the right cleat for the surface is essential for longevity.
Grass Fields
Grass fields offer a relatively forgiving surface, but the type of grass and the field’s condition still matter:
- Soft Grass: Soft, well-maintained grass fields generally put less stress on cleats.
- Hard, Dry Grass: Hard, dry grass can be more abrasive and cause faster wear.
- Stud Length: Choose studs appropriate for the grass length and ground conditions. Longer studs may be needed for softer ground.
Artificial Turf
Artificial turf presents a different set of challenges:
- Abrasion: Artificial turf is more abrasive than natural grass, putting more stress on the cleat’s outsole and studs.
- Stud Design: Cleats designed for artificial turf have shorter, more numerous studs to provide better grip without excessive penetration.
- Heat: Artificial turf can get very hot, potentially accelerating material degradation.
Indoor Surfaces

- Indoor Soccer Shoes: Indoor soccer shoes have flat, non-marking soles for optimal grip on smooth surfaces. Using cleats indoors is generally not recommended due to the risk of damaging the floor and the cleats.
- Futsal Shoes: Futsal shoes are designed for indoor play and offer excellent grip and maneuverability.
Troubleshooting Common Cleat Issues
Even with proper care, cleats can experience various issues. Here’s how to troubleshoot some common problems:
Stud Issues
- Loose Studs: Tighten loose studs immediately. If they continue to loosen, consider using a thread sealant.
- Broken Studs: Replace broken studs promptly.
- Worn Studs: Replace worn studs to maintain optimal traction.
Upper Issues
- Tears: Small tears can often be repaired with adhesive or stitching. Larger tears may require professional repair.
- Cracking: Cracking in the upper is often a sign of material degradation. Replace the cleats if the cracking is extensive.
- Separation from Sole: If the upper separates from the sole, it’s usually best to take the cleats to a professional for repair or consider replacing them.
Sole Issues
- Delamination: If the sole starts to separate from the midsole, it’s time for professional repair or replacement.
- Wear and Tear: Excessive wear on the sole can reduce traction and stability. Consider replacing the cleats if the wear is significant.
Choosing the Right Cleat for Your Sport
The specific cleat design varies considerably depending on the sport. Here’s a brief overview of cleat styles for some popular sports:
Soccer Cleats
Soccer cleats are designed for agility and quick movements:
- Conical Studs: Typically feature conical studs for excellent traction and maneuverability on grass fields.
- Lightweight Design: Soccer cleats are often lightweight to enhance speed and agility.
- Low-Profile Design: Designed to provide close contact with the ball.
Football Cleats
Football cleats prioritize traction and support:
- Aggressive Studs: Feature longer, more aggressive studs for maximum traction on grass fields.
- High-Top or Mid-Top Designs: Provide ankle support and stability.
- Durable Construction: Built to withstand the demands of physical contact.
Baseball/softball Cleats
Baseball and softball cleats focus on traction for running and lateral movements:
- Metal or Molded Studs: Metal studs provide superior grip on grass fields, while molded studs are suitable for both grass and artificial turf.
- Toe Stud: Often feature a toe stud for improved traction when running.
- Durable Uppers: Designed to withstand sliding and wear.
Track and Field Spikes
Track and field spikes are designed for speed and performance on the track:
- Spikes: Feature replaceable spikes for optimal grip on the track.
- Lightweight Design: Extremely lightweight to minimize weight and maximize speed.
- Specific Designs: Different designs for sprinting, distance running, and jumping events.
